very simple. it measures the depth of the slot. the ACE style tubular key has 7 pin slots. So looking at the end of the key you put in the lock, counting clockwise,
position 1 through 7. so position 1 might have a depth of "3",
position 2 might be 7, and so on. depth is measured how long the cut is made tward the handle of the key. it is used to replicate an existing key.

The Herty Gerty is a compact, hand-operated tubular key machine. Code cuts #137 standard tubular blanks - offsets left, offsets right, and even pin within a pin (requires accessory #CS). Cuts any spacing 0 to 360 degrees. The Herty Gerty may also be used to duplicate by using tubular key decoder which is included. To rekey locks effectively and efficiently, follow these steps: Gather necessary tools such as a key decoder, plug follower, and new key pins. Remove the lock cylinder from the door. Use the key decoder to determine the pin sizes needed for the new key. Replace the old key pins with the new ones according to the key decoder. Reassemble the lock cylinder and test the new key to ensure it works smoothly.
